🚇 🗺️ Getting There
The Colgate Clock is located in Jeffersonville, Indiana, on the banks of the Ohio River. It's easily visible from the Louisville, Kentucky side as well. Driving is the most common way to access it, with parking available nearby, especially for events.
Yes, the Colgate Clock is a prominent landmark visible from many points in downtown Louisville, Kentucky, across the Ohio River.
While direct public transport to the immediate vicinity might be limited, you can reach the general area via local bus routes in Jeffersonville. Check TARC (Transit Authority of River City) for routes serving the area.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
No, the Colgate Clock is a public landmark and can be viewed from the riverfront at any time. There are no admission fees.
The clock is a permanent fixture and can be viewed 24/7. It is particularly striking when illuminated at night.
Parking availability and cost can vary. Street parking may be available, and for larger events like Thunder Over Louisville, designated parking areas are often provided for a fee.
🎫 📍 Onsite Experience
The area around the Colgate Clock offers scenic riverfront views. It's a popular spot for walks, photography, and especially for viewing the annual Thunder Over Louisville event.
Yes, the clock is maintained and remains operational, keeping time and often illuminated at night.
It's a historic landmark that has been a recognizable symbol of the Ohio River region for decades, representing industrial heritage.
📸 📸 Photography
Golden hour (shortly after sunrise or before sunset) offers beautiful light. Nighttime photography is also popular when the clock is illuminated, providing a dramatic contrast.
The Louisville riverfront provides excellent, unobstructed views of the Colgate Clock. From Jeffersonville, you can get closer, but the iconic wide shots are often from the opposite bank.

Experiencing Thunder Over Louisville
Attending Thunder Over Louisville from the Jeffersonville side, near the Colgate Clock, provides a unique perspective. While the event draws massive crowds, the parking and accessibility near the clock are often praised by attendees who have experienced it. It's recommended to arrive early to secure good spots and navigate the increased traffic smoothly.
Beyond the main event, the riverfront itself offers a pleasant atmosphere for enjoying the spectacle. The Colgate Clock, illuminated against the night sky, adds to the memorable backdrop of this spectacular celebration.
